Mafia 3 video game will feature lots of period music, Playboy deal hinted at

Given how popular Rockstar’s Grand Theft Auto franchise is, it is hard to forget that there are other GTA-style games in the market too. An example is the Mafia series, with Mafia II being one of the best GTA clones made to date. That game took place in the 40’s and took a tip from the Godfather movies, with Italian protagonist Vito Scaletta attempting to take over the criminal underworld after returning from World War II.

And the upcoming Mafia III is set in the late 60’s in the fictional city of New Bordeaux (which is based on real-life New Orleans) in a time of social upheaval and popular discontent, with Vietnam vet Lincoln Clay returning to his home city only to find that his gang has been put down by the Italian mob.

Mafia III will offer gameplay similar to Rockstar’s games, with plenty of shooting, reckless driving, and plenty of story missions to complete in New Bordeaux. Like Rockstar’s games, Mafia III will feature plenty of period music, as we’ve already heard the likes of “House of the Rising Sun” and “All along the Watchtower” in the game’s trailers.

Mafia III’s creative director has also made it clear that the game will feature authentic period music through and through, stating that “We’re being really hardcore about the music selections, and making sure that nothing in our playlist is from after 1968”. And Rolling Stones fans will surely be delighted to hear that the band’s 1966 hit “Paint it Black” will also be part of Mafia III’s soundtrack.

Aside from authentic period music, it seems that the Playboy magazines which featured in earlier Mafia games will also appear in this latest Mafia game, as the developers have tweeted about some kind of promo deal with Playboy that will be announced on June 1. Apparently model Eugena Washington (who was recently named Playmate of the year…) will be involved in some way or another.

It remains to be seen though, whether this Mafia game will shine or sink this year, but it surely would be great thing for fans of GTA-style games if Mafia III turned out to be as good as its predecessor when it’s released later this year.

Note: Mafia III will be released on October 7, 2016. Available on PS4, Xbox One and PC.
